Ed Hughes’ new opera States of Innocence, based on Milton’s Paradise Lost with a libretto by Peter Cant, premieres at the Brighton Festival on Sunday 19th May 2024 in a concert performance with video projection by Ian Winters, starring legendary bass Sir John Tomlinson as Milton with mezzo soprano Rozanna Madylus as Milton’s Wife / Eve and tenor Stuart Jackson as Milton’s Assistant / Satan. With New Music Players conducted by Andrew Gourlay.
